Online Auction for Nothing But Nets Tournament Has Begun

4/27/2009 4:13:07 PM | Men's Basketball

DAVIDSON, N.C. - The 3-on-3 tournament in support of Nothing But Nets takes place May 3 in Belk Arena, and the online silent auction with 11 quality items has already begun.

Bids can be made here and wil be accepted until 4 p.m. May 3. Those attending the event will still be able to participate in the online silent auction as computers will be set up in the arena, and volunteers will be available to facilitate the bidding process.

The tournament is a double-elimination event for 3rd-8th graders, who will be split into three divisions, with 10 teams in each. There are four players on each team, and the registration fee is $50 per team. Teams are asked to raise extra money by getting sponsors, and teams will have the opportunity to choose a Davidson player to be their coach through a draft based on the amount of money they raised. All participants will get a free t-shirt to be worn as a jersey during the competition. A live auction with five items will take place after the tournament.

“Nothing But Nets” is a non-profit organization that is dedicated to providing nets for families in Africa to aid in the prevention of malaria and other insect related diseases. For just $10, you can provide a net that can protect a whole family from a disease that kills approximately 3,000 people a day and someone every 30 seconds.
